Added sugar hides in processed foods, nuts, sauces and condiments. “That means you have to learn to be a good label reader and know the different types of sugar so you can identify them,” says Chicago-based nutritionist and chef Sarah Haas, RDN, LDN.

Sugar has many aliases, such as high fructose corn syrup, honey, molasses, malt syrup, sucrose, cane sugar, dextrose, agave, and maple syrup. The list goes on.

The good news is that counting added sugar in grams is getting easier, thanks to changes in food labeling requirements. Many products now include added sugar under the total sugar label.

By 2020, companies with revenues over $10 million will be required by law to list all added sugar in grams. And in 2021, low-income companies will be required to comply.
